Feel like your phone could do more? You’re not alone. Most of us use the same handful of features every day and miss out on handy shortcuts that save time, improve battery life, and keep data safe. Below are quick, no‑setup tips you can start using right now.
First, close apps you’re not using. On Android, swipe them away from the recent‑apps screen; on iPhone, swipe up from the bottom and flick the app. It frees RAM and makes switching feel smoother.
Next, turn off animations. In Android’s developer options, disable "window animation scale" and similar settings. On iPhone, go to Settings > Accessibility > Motion and turn on "Reduce Motion". The phone feels snappier without the fancy transitions.
Finally, clear the cache of heavy apps like browsers or social media. Open the app’s storage settings and tap "Clear cache". You’ll reclaim space and notice faster load times.
Low‑power mode is a lifesaver. On iPhone, enable it in Settings > Battery; on Android, tap the battery icon and select "Battery Saver". It limits background activity and dims the screen.
Adjust screen brightness manually instead of using auto‑brightness. The eye‑sensor can keep the display brighter than needed, draining the battery faster.
Turn off unused connections like Bluetooth, NFC, or Wi‑Fi when you’re not using them. A quick swipe down on the notification shade (Android) or up from the bottom right corner (iPhone) lets you toggle these off in seconds.
If you can, use dark mode on OLED screens. Dark pixels use less power, so apps that support dark mode give you an extra battery boost.
Lastly, check which apps consume the most power. In Settings > Battery (iPhone) or Settings > Battery > Battery usage (Android), you’ll see a list. Restrict background activity for the top offenders.
These tweaks take less than five minutes to set up, but they add up to hours of extra use each week.
